JetBlue Expanding Mint Service in the Caribbean

A Mint "suite" on JetBlue.

JetBlue is continuing its expansion of its Mint premium cabin service in the Caribbean.

The carrier has announced plans to add seasonal Mint service on flights between Boston and St. Maarten’s Princess Juliana International Airport.

“When we set out to reinvent premium travel nearly three years ago, we knew we were on to something revolutionary,” said Marty St. George, executive vice president, JetBlue.

The Mint service will be offered on JetBlue’s Saturday service between Boston and St. Maarten between Nov. 4 and April 2018.

JetBlue has also announced plans to include a second Saturday roundtrip flight between New York and Barbados with Mint service, complementing existing year-round Saturday Mint service between New York and Barbados.

JetBlue is also adding more Mint service on peak travel days between New York and St. Maarten, with a second daily roundtrip being added over the Christmas peak and on Saturdays before and after Thanksgiving.

JetBlue is resuming its Mint service on existing routes including New York-Grenada, New York-St. Lucia, New York-St Maarten, Boston-Barbados and Boston Aruba.
